html 배너 링크를 그룹마다 다른 링크로 보내려고하는데요
CMS/프레임워크 | Rhymix 2.0 |
---|---|
개발 언어 | PHP 7.3 |
<script>
if($logged_info->group_list[309]){
<a href="https://naver.com">;
} else if($logged_info->group_list[4749]){
<a href="https://daum.net">;
} else if($logged_info->group_list[4750]){
<a href="https://google.co.kr">;
} else{
<a href="https://www.nate.com/">;
}
</script>
<img alt="" data-file-srl="9459" editor_component="image_link" src="/files/attach/images/sub/1.jpg"; width="600" height="300"/></a>
이것저것 테스트해보는데 역시 많이 부족해서 ㅠ_ㅠ
답이없네요.
혹시 좋은 방안이 있을까요?
댓글 6
<a href="https://daum.net" cond="$logged_info->group_list[4749]">
<a href="https://google.co.kr" cond="$logged_info->group_list[4750]">
<img alt="" data-file-srl="9459" editor_component="image_link" src="/files/attach/images/sub/1.png"; width="600" height="300"/></a></p>
실패2 ㅠㅠ
<a href="https://naver.com">
<!--@end-->
<!--@if($logged_info->group_list[4749])-->
<a href="https://daum.net">
<!--@end-->
<!--@if($logged_info->group_list[4750])-->
<a href="https://google.co.kr">
<!--@end-->
<!--@if($is_logged)-->
<a href="https://nate.com">
<!--@end-->
실패 3
1. 본문에서 스크립트 태그는 필요 없어보입니다.
2. 회원그룹이 중복되는 경우는 없는가 보죠? 만약 그렇다면 조건문이 array_key_exists(숫자, $logged_info->group_list) 같은 식이 되어야 할 것 같아요.
그런데 그룹마다 다른 url로 안가지고
계속 똑같은지 모르겠네요.
비회원은 <a href>가 작동 안되게 걸었는데도 계속 url이 들어가져요 ㅠㅠ
대강 이렇게 표현해볼 수 있을 겁니다.
<!--@if($logged_info->group_list[1])-->
<a href="https://naver.com">
<!--@else-->
<a href="https://nate.com">
<!--@end-->
1</a>
여름 건강 유의하시구요.